You’re always on your iPad
Or on the wretched phone.
Bloody social media
Leave the phone alone!
Forget about who follows
Whether you got likes,
Those tweets or notifications
The so called Facebook friends.
We are here, we’re in the room
Communicate with us.
You’re Facebook friends will still be there
So why the ruddy rush?
Let’s do stuff together
The way we used to do?
See what’s on the telly
That all of us can view.
Don’t look out the window
Don’t go out the door
There’s nothing happens off a screen
That matters any more.
Wave a phone before your face
See life through a lense
Nothing counts in modern life
That isn’t on a screen.
